When a board-topper like Ryan Watts slides to the 251st pick, you do not overthink it, and the Packers did not. The bottom line is a respectable B-.
Spending an early pick on safety with edge rusher, quarterback and other spots open is the decision the grade keeps circling back to. They covered a lot of ground and still skipped edge rusher, which is a strange place to end up. Every board in the league had Powers-Johnson lower, and that gap is the story.
They left with cornerback solved and the rest of the wish list mostly ticked off.
All told, a solid class that does its job everywhere but edge rusher.
